Super outbreak of 1974, also called tornado super outbreak of 1974, series of tornadoes that caused severe damage to the midwestern, southern, and eastern united states and ontario, canada, on april 34, 1974. The 1974 super outbreak was the first tornado outbreak in recorded history to produce more than 100 tornadoes in under a 24hour period, a feat that was not repeated globally until the 1981 united kingdom tornado outbreak and in the united states until the 2011 super outbreak.
